Tabanus atratus (organism)
SCTID: 89769004, Primitive, Active
89769004 |Tabanus atratus (organism)|
832731018 - Tabanus atratus (organism) (en) View
148827019 - Tabanus atratus (en) View
Relationship (294915022) - 89769004 -> 4823003 (116680003) View
Relationship (2943055027) - 89769004 -> 421153008 (116680003) View
421153008 View
No recent searches